Jana Reddy,  a seven-time MLA and former Panchayat Raj minister, was on Tuesday chosen to be the Congress Legislature Party leader in Telangana Assembly. Jana is the first CLP leader in the new state of Telangana.

Senior Congress leaders Vayalar Ravi and Digvijay Singh attended the meet as observers.  When all the 21 party legislators were asked to spell out their choice,  they unanimously elected Jana Reddy.  Out of the 21 MLAs , 20 MLAs attended the meeting and one skipped the meeting citing personnel reasons.

Telangana Congress Committee leadership had two options; firstly, to leave the decision to the party High Command or to have the MLAs elect the leader. Sources said that Jana Reddy, Geetha Reddy, DK Aruna and Uttam Kumar Reddy were in the race. Since the party High Command was unable to choose from  those in the race, they left the decision to the MLAs.  

Speaking to media after the elections, Digvijaya Singh said that he hoped  Jana,  along with other Congress MLAs will work as effective and constructive opposition in the Telangana Assembly. 

An overwhelmed Jana said that they would keep the pressure on the ruling party to implement all the promises they made during the elections. He exuded confidence that they would bring Congress back to power in 2019 elections. He also thanked Sonia Gandhi for giving Telangana while sacrificing Andhra.
